Fedorchuk
Fedorchuk is a surname of the Ukrainian origin. It is associated with the given Christian name of Theodore and its derivatives may include Fedoruk and Fedorenko.
Surnames Frequency by Census Records
FEDORCHUK
According to the U.S. Census Bureau, Fedorchuk is ranked #76275 in terms of the most common surnames in America.
The Fedorchuk surname appeared 252 times in the 2010 census and if you were to sample 100,000 people in the United States, approximately 0 would have the surname Fedorchuk.
97.2% or 245 total occurrences were White.
1.9% or 5 total occurrences were of Hispanic origin.
